Having the best devices ready will make your relocation a little less painful. You'll desire these supplies on hand:

Boxes for your stuff. This one is apparent. Get about double what you're thinking, since you do not wish to overload them, and you certainly do not wish to run out of boxes at the last minute!
Bubble wrap and packaging paper to protect belongings. Usage packaging tape to seal boxes.
Plastic sandwich bags, blank sticker labels, and permanent markers. You'll discover why later on.

Sort. And Purge.

Let's face it: All of us have a great deal of things that we just do not need. Do you actually wish to pack up, haul, and unload things you never ever utilize and don't care about? Prior to you pack anything, start by separating things you need from stuff you do not.

Start in the storage area of your house. The basement, the attic, a closet - any place you keep that mass of stuff you think you require however never ever utilize.
Go through things. If you haven't used, looked at, or at least thought of something in a couple of years, separate it into the "purge" pile.
Do not be scared to keep prized possessions or special products - even if you don't use them typically. Put these kinds of items together, and load them safely in case you don't open them for a while.

Get Packaging

The minute of truth has shown up. All your preparation has actually boiled down to this. Keep a couple of things in mind while you're packing:

Don't forget to wrap breakables in bubble wrap or packing paper.
Make certain to line the bottom of your boxes with foam peanuts or crumpled-up newspaper. Place the heavier items on the bottom and the lighter items on the top.
When whatever is crammed in a particular box, sprinkle in some more packaging peanuts, tape up the box, and label it.

Preparing Furnishings

It's appealing not to prep furniture and hope that everything survives the move without a scratch. But taking a couple of extra minutes on the front end can save you from getting a huge headache. Here are a few ideas to keep your furniture safeguarded during the move:

Bolts, nuts, and washers go in a plastic bag, which can then be taped to the underside of a piece of furnishings. For products that have a lot of private elements, utilize the stickers to identify each item so you can quickly assemble the furnishings again.
Apply wax to fine woods to prevent scratches.
Put pillows and coverings in plastic garbage bags. Ensure to secure the bags so debris can't get in.
Wrap essential furniture with blankets or bubble wrap for extra protection.
